Transaction 24815b566773c40520732976a4a3fc933edbcdf5ecf2bb9827e0a99bde9dc39e
1 Input
1 Output
-
24815b566773c40520732976a4a3fc933edbcdf5ecf2bb9827e0a99bde9dc39e:0
- value
- 58094
- script pubkey
- OP_0 OP_PUSHBYTES_20 de85de9c9a40539d192fc7f450acb321f6b7b8e1
- address
- bc1qm6zaa8y6gpfe6xf0cl69pt9ny8mt0w8pch7hlq